About The Position

The Billing Specialist is responsible for assisting in the day-to-day operations of the Billing Department and timely and accurate professional billing. Role is also responsible for ensuring compliance with all organizational, statutory, and federal, contractual obligations, regulations, and standards. This position serves as “super-user” for billing systems, including but not limited to maintaining edits, bridge routines, and establishing and maintaining billing system vendor and IT relationships.

Responsibilities

  • Provides daily administration and coordination of billing functions
  • Supports billing and collections, and data processing to ensure accurate billing and efficient account collection.
  • Reviews reports, works queues, monitors department’s productivity, recommends improvements to enhance the unit’s productivity and meet goals.
  • Serves as the practice expert and go to person for all billing processes, limited coding questions and help resolve issues.
  • Maintains contacts with other departments to obtain and analyze additional patient information to document and process billings.
  • Supports and performs the operations of the billing department including but not limited to; medical coding, charge entry, claims submissions, payment posting, accounts receivable follow-up, and reimbursement management.
  • Audits current procedures to monitor and improve efficiency of billing and collections operations.
  • Ensures that the activities of the billing operations are conducted in a manner that is consistent with overall department protocol, and follow Federal, State, and payer regulations, guidelines, and requirements.
  • Participates in the development and application of operating policies and procedures.
  • Reviews and interprets operational data to assess need for procedural revisions and enhancements.
  • Participates in the design and implementation of specific systems to enhance revenue and operating efficiency.
